Abstract

This study examines the impact of urbanization, tourism, and manufacturing on economic growth in Lampung Province. Secondary data from the Central Statistics Agency (BPS) for the period 2014–2023 were used. The analytical method used was multiple linear regression. The results indicate that the tourism sector has a positive and statistically significant impact on economic growth, while the urbanization and manufacturing variables have a positive but insignificant influence. At the same time, all independent variables have a significant impact on economic growth. The coefficient of determination (R²) of 0.851 indicates that 85.1% of the variance in economic growth can be explained by the model. These findings confirm the strategic role of the tourism sector as a major driver of regional economic growth and the importance of strengthening the quality of urban development and the competitiveness of the manufacturing sector in Lampung Province.
